你查询的IP:[116.4.195.202]  地理位置:中国–广东–东莞

最新查询218.56.81.231 125.64.75.219 219.72.12.164 120.92.56.162 116.196.143.205 119.96.48.131 120.80.254.178 202.165.208.10 202.91.128.150 116.4.195.202 192.188.170.220 58.240.65.52 202.14.88.252 119.15.136.233 221.199.226.241 118.66.224.174 203.207.64.245 202.4.128.162 119.40.64.158 123.196.242.11 202.136.208.206 202.149.224.89 202.90.224.188 202.122.101.1 60.194.105.185 121.51.202.221 202.149.160.112 114.54.54.111 119.20.155.180 203.207.64.93 58.128.210.32